What I Looked for in the Design
For me, the design was the first thing to consider. I paid attention to details like curved lines, carved accents, antique-style finishes, and metal or wood frames with a worn-in look. I found that the right vintage style should feel elegant but not overly ornate. I also made sure the frame matched the overall mood I wanted for my bedroom.
Choosing the Right Material
I noticed that the material made a big difference in both appearance and durability. Wooden vintage look bed frames gave me a cozy, classic feel, while metal frames offered a more romantic or industrial antique style. I preferred solid wood or sturdy metal because I wanted something that would last and still look beautiful over time.
Checking the Build Quality
I learned quickly that a pretty frame is not enough. I checked the joints, support slats, center legs, and overall sturdiness before making a decision. A vintage look bed frame should not only look old-fashioned; it should also feel solid and reliable. I always looked for good craftsmanship because that gave me confidence in the purchase.
Making Sure It Fits My Space
Before buying, I measured my room carefully. I made sure the frame would fit comfortably without making the space feel crowded. I also checked the height of the bed frame, since that affected how the room looked and how easy it was for me to get in and out of bed. In my experience, proportions matter just as much as style.
Thinking About Comfort and Mattress Support
I never focused only on the frame’s appearance. I also made sure it would support my mattress properly. A good vintage look bed frame should provide stable support and work well with the mattress type I already had. I looked for slats or a platform base that kept the mattress secure and comfortable.
Considering Color and Finish
The finish changed the whole feel of the bed frame for me. Distressed white, matte black, antique brass, walnut, and weathered oak each created a different vintage mood. I chose a finish that matched my existing furniture and the atmosphere I wanted in my bedroom. I found that softer, aged finishes often looked more authentic.
Looking at Maintenance Needs
I also thought about how much care the frame would need. Some vintage-style finishes can show dust, scratches, or wear more easily. I preferred a frame that was easy to clean and maintain without losing its charm. For me, the best choice was one that looked beautiful but did not require too much effort to keep in good shape.
